Since the international financial crisis,the shadow banking business has become the focus of attention in the domestic and foreign financial circles.The shadow banking scale in China is expanding in a specific environment and period,and its position in China's financial market is becoming increasingly prominent.The essence of shadow banking in China is loan-like business.It forms a complementary relationship with traditional banks.Its characteristics of dependence on banks and out of supervision have a certain impact on the stability of commercial banks.On the one hand,the rapid development of shadow banks has accelerated the business innovation of commercial banks.While developing off-balance-sheet business,commercial banks have increased their profit and optimized their income structure.At the same time,because of its own characteristics of regulatory arbitrage,the strict regulatory for traditional banks often fail to work on shadow banks,which will greatly reduce the effect of the central bank's regulatory policies and affect the stability of commercial banks.Therefore,the content of this paper has important theoretical and practical significance.Firstly,this paper measures the stability of 46 sample commercial banks in the 11-year period from 2007 to 2017 by the comprehensive index scoring method,and constructs a commercial bank stability index which can measure the stability of commercial banks.On this basis,the panel data model is used to empirically analyze the impact of the scale expansion of shadow banks on the stability of 46 representative commercial banks and different types of commercial banks.Empirical research shows that the stability index of Chinese commercial banks can be adjusted by the size of shadow banks to some extent.They show a significant inverted U-shaped relationship.Therefore,properly expanding the size of shadow banks in the current period will help to improve the stability index of commercial banks.Although the development of shadow banking will bring some risks,as long as the regulations improved,the negative effects and risks brought by shadow banking will be effectively prevented,and the good growth of national economy can be promoted on the basis of maintaining the stability of commercial banks.
